What Causes Bilateral TMJ—and Why Bilateral TMJ Injections May Help Both Sides

Pain or discomfort in the jaw can start subtly—perhaps as a clicking sound while chewing or tightness near the ears when waking. For some people, these symptoms may develop into a more persistent condition known as temporomandibular joint dysfunction (TMD). TMD is an umbrella term that includes various disorders affecting the temporomandibular joints (TMJs)—the joints that connect your lower jaw to your skull. These joints play a crucial role in everyday functions, such as speaking, chewing, and yawning.
